Connect to a Wi-Fi
Connecting to a Wi-Fi network is a handy way of accessing the internet. When out and about,
you can connect to Wi-Fi networks in public places, such as a library or internet café.
Your phone periodically checks for and notifies you of available connections. The notification
appears briefly at the top of the screen. To manage your Wi-Fi connections, select the
notification.

Wi-Fi positioning improves positioning accuracy when satellite signals are not available,
especially when you are indoors or between tall buildings.
Close the connection
Switch Wi-Fi networking to Off
Tip: Your phone connects back to the Wi-Fi network automatically. To change the
automatic reconnection time, or to switch Wi-Fi back on manually, tap Turn Wi-Fi back
on and the option you want.
